Abstract:

Deflection and rotation of beams can be determined by various methods available in the literature. In this investigation, a new method based on the Taylor series expansion called Taylor method is introduced. The method yields two single equations for calculation of deflection and the rotation of the beam regardless of the loading and supports conditions. The method employs the governing differential equations for deflection of beams in mechanics of solids along with Taylor series expansion. The equations of shear force and bending moment can be determined using Taylor series and without resorting to their corresponding diagrams. The method is examined by solving a number of beam problems. The results indicate that the method can be used with confidence for solving any problemrelated to the beam’s deflection. The method also seems to be more convenient and more efficient than the other methods.
